Purpose:

Under general direction, coordinates administrative operations and the workflow of clerical support staff while delivering high-level administrative support to departmental leadership and teams. Manages complex assignments, facilitates communication and process improvement initiatives, and utilizes independent judgment to support organizational objectives and operational efficiency.
Responsibilities:
 
  • Plans conferences for department and department head
  • Under general direction coordinates the workflow of employee(s) and provides administrative support of a complex and technical nature to single or multiple department or division (i.e., organizes, plans, and prioritizes work of others, develops and builds teams to accomplish project assignments)
  • Performs all responsibilities of an Administrative Assistant Sr
  • Provides input to presentations and other department/supervisor work (i.e., supervisor provides general thought and ee will draft more material based on initial ideas)
  • Reviews administrative procedures and operating practices and makes recommendations to increase efficiency.
  • Assists in recruiting, hiring, training, and evaluating the performance of employees
  • Analyzes complex information requests and determines complex trends
  • Develops reports for executive or department
  • Develops and sends correspondence on behalf of department and department head (i.e., draft and send meeting minutes, draft and send meeting events)
